How to Use Your Slow Cooker
1. Before first use, wash Cover and Crock in hot, soapy
water. Rinse and dry. Do not immerse Base in water.
2. Prepare recipe according to instructions. Place food in
Crock and cover.
3. Plug cord into outlet. Select temperature setting.
4. When finished, turn to Off and unplug Base. Remove food
from Crock.
5. Let Crock and Cover cool slightly before washing.
Cleaning Your Slow Cooker
1. Turn the Control Knob to Off. Unplug cord from outlet.
2. Remove Crock and Cover from Base and let cool.
3. Wash the Crock and the Cover in hot, soapy water. Rinse
and dry. The Crock and the Cover may also be washed in
the dishwasher.
4. Wipe the Base with a damp cloth. Do not use abrasive
cleansers.
Caution: To reduce the risk of electrical shock, do not
immerse Base in water.
Crock and Glass Cover:
Precautions and Information
• Please handle the Crock and Cover carefully to ensure
long life.
• Avoid sudden, extreme temperature changes. For example,
do not place a hot Cover or Crock into cold water, or onto
a wet surface.
